Bear was adopted from a shelter in Idaho Falls, Idaho. He is currently 5 years old, almost six. We got him when he was 8 months old. He is an LGD and is very smart. He has gone through basic training twice. He is very large and loves attention. He is needing a family that can give him a lot of love and attention, as well as a home with a tall fence or a lot of land. He is very protective over his home/family, and might be suited better with a family or couple who will only have him as a pet. Him being an older dog he is stubborn, but he is very loving. He loves belly scratches and treats. He does listen to commands (sit, paw, down) for snacks.
